Finnish defenseman Joni Pitkanen wore this helmet while helping his country to win bronze during the 2010 Olympic men’s hockey tournament. Pitkanen appeared in five of Finland’s six games in Vancouver, contributing a goal and two assists, including a helper to set up the go-ahead goal as Olli Jokinen scored twice during a three-goal outburst in the third to send the Finns on to a 5-3 win over Slovakia in the bronze-medal game at Canada Hockey Place on February 27. CCM helmet with an Oakley visor features “Vancouver 2010” decal with Olympic rings on the front. Decals with Pitkanen’s #25 appear on the back above another “Vancouver 2010” decal. This Olympic gamer is the correct model used by Pitkanen during the tournament. Light game wear shows in scrapes and scratches. Comes with an LOA.
